Friday's USL League Two playoff action saw Dothan United win the Southern Conference championship, advancing to Sunday's national semifinal. Ft Lauderdale United charged forward from the opening whistle, looking to take a quick lead. Dothan weathered the storm, and made a hard press of their own. A hand ball in the box drew a PK for Dothan in the 16th minute. Santiago Hoyos converted to take the lead. Four minutes later, Hoyos got his brace. Dothan held that 2-0 lead until Ft Lauderdale pulled one back in the 65th minute. There were some tense moments from that point forward, but Dothan held on to secure the 2-1 victory. In fifteen league games this season (including the playoffs) the Dragons have never allowed more than one goal in a game, conceding just 7 for the entire season. And they've put up 8 clean sheets. They'll be leaning on that defense when they face Vermont Green on Sunday, July 27 at 6:30 Eastern time (5:30 Central).

Vermont Green needed overtime to beat Lionsbridge on Friday night. Regular time ended tied up at 1-1, but Vermont surged and got two more in overtime to put it to bed 3-1 to win the Eastern Conference championship. There was a huge crowd on hand, and they'll be back in force on Sunday.
The winner of Sunday's match will move on to play for the national championship.
